Loot Slash Conquer
Loot Slash Conquer is an engaging action-RPG modification inspired by the legendary Hack/Mine mod. Embark on expeditions through vast procedurally generated towers and dungeons, collect various types of loot, and experience thousands of unique weapon combinations while conquering the Minecraft world.
Note: Loot Slash Conquer is in alpha testing stage and actively under development. However, most features listed below have already been implemented.
Key Features
- Character classes and abilities — choose your playstyle with unique skills for each class
- Player statistics system — improve damage, health, attack speed, movement speed, mana, health regeneration, critical chance, and much more
- Leveling and experience — grow stronger with each new character level
- Randomly generated weapons and armor — items with levels, rarities, individual damage and defense values, and special attributes
- New equipment types — daggers, maces, staves, light/heavy armor, bows, and much more
- Unique monsters — each enemy possesses their own attacks, artificial intelligence, and abilities
- Complex bosses — powerful opponents with unique battle phases and special skills
- Procedurally generated dungeons and towers — endless opportunities for exploration and valuable trophy collection
- Handcrafted boss dungeons — massive locations requiring full completion before the boss encounter
- Numerous new items — scrolls, glyphs, and other useful items
- Sophisticated loot system — find randomly generated items throughout the world regardless of their origin
- Area leveling system — the world becomes more dangerous but equally rewarding as you move further from spawn
- Random monster statistics — all enemies receive individual parameters scaling according to territory level
- Compatibility with other mods — weapons and armor from other mods automatically integrate into LSC's randomization system, while monsters receive levels and tiers
